Miami, FL (April 24, 2025) – Regional Mexican music icon Alejandro Fernández unveils his highly anticipated album ‘De Rey a Rey’ —a powerful tribute that transcends music to become a heartfelt love letter to his late father, Vicente Fernández, and to his beloved Mexico. Through timeless rancheras and soul-stirring lyrics, Alejandro honors his father’s enduring legacy, reviving the voice that shaped a generation and touched hearts around the world.
Produced by Edén Muñoz, ‘De Rey a Rey’ was recorded live at the Plaza de Toros ‘La México’ in Mexico City and brings together emblematic songs from Don Vicente’s repertoire, along with deeply personal interpretations that Alejandro delivers on stage with raw emotion. Each track is a portrait of shared moments, teachings passed down and a family’s love turned into music.

His versatility has allowed him to master both pop and Regional Mexican charts and has led him to collaborate with more than 35 international artists, including Maná, Juan Gabriel, Julio Iglesias, Christina Aguilera, Beyoncé, Plácido Domingo, Rod Stewart, and Alejandro Sanz.
Alejandro is the first artist to achieve #1 album sales in four consecutive decades (1990s, 2000s, 2010s, and 2020s). He continues to dominate the digital space with 900 million streams annually on Spotify, a spot in Pandora’s Billionaires Program, and over 8 billion YouTube views, cementing his global reach and enduring popularity.
Similarly, El Potrillo has earned 4 Latin GRAMMYs, including “Best Ranchero/Mariachi Album” for his seventeenth album ‘Te Llevo en la Sangre’ (2024). He also has a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ame, holds a spot on Billboard’s Hall of Fame, received the “Icon Award” at the Latin AMAS, and the “Excellence Award” at Premio Lo Nuestro and Premios Soberano, among other honors recognizing his contributions to music.
Beyond his music, Fernández has a long history of giving back. In 2020, he dedicated his Latin GRAMMY win to the victims of southern Mexico’s hurricanes and donated 1,000,000 MXN to the Mexican Red Cross. In 2023, he partnered with Teletón México to support those affected by Hurricane Otis in Acapulco. That same year, the U.S. Congress honored Alejandro for his four decades of contributions to Mexican music and Latin culture, highlighting his humanitarian efforts.
Alejandro has been touring for over 30 years, performing live for fans in 18 countries across the U.S., Latin America, and Europe. In 2003, he began the annual Fiestas Patrias tradition in Las Vegas, and he is now the top-selling solo artist in the city’s history, with 22 consecutive years of performances. In his home country of Mexico, he broke records at the iconic Plaza de Toros La México, becoming the first and only artist to sell out four concerts there, with over 160,000 total attendees. He has also been invited four times (2001, 2006, 2015, and 2023) to the prestigious Viña del Mar Festival, the largest Latin music event in the world.
